Comprehending Hobs

Hobs, commonly understood as cooktops or stovetops, are devices created for cooking food. They are available in various types, consisting of gas, electrical, induction, and more. The option of hob can considerably affect cooking time, energy consumption, and total cooking area looks.

Kinds of Hobs

TypeDescriptionProsCons
GasUses gas flames to heat pots and pansQuick temperature level adjustmentsNeeds a gas line setup
ElectricUtilizes heating elements to create heatNormally easy to set upSlow to cool down
InductionUtilizes electromagnetic energy to straight heat up cookwareExtremely efficient; cool to touchNeeds compatible cookware
CeramicFlat surface area with heated coils underneath the glass layerStreamlined design; simple to tidyLess efficient than induction
Double FuelCombines gas cooking with electric ovensFlexible cooking alternativesMore costly, requires dual source of power

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the distinction between induction and gas hobs?

Induction hobs heat pots and pans straight through electromagnetic energy, leading to much faster cooking times and less residual heat. Gas hobs, on the other hand, usage flames for cooking, providing instantaneous heat control however can take longer to cool down.

2. Are hobs easy to set up?

Setup might differ based on the type of hob. Gas hobs usually require expert installation due to safety issues, while electrical and induction hobs can typically be installed by the house owner if they have the electrical understanding.

3. How can I clean my hob effectively?

Hob cleaning requires different techniques based upon the material. For induction and ceramic hobs, using a soft cloth and particular cleansing options is suggested. Gas hobs might need disassembling the burners for thorough cleaning.

4. Exist any security includes to think about?

Lots of contemporary hobs come equipped with safety functions such as kid locks, automated shut-off, and heat indications, which warn when the surface is still hot.

5. How energy-efficient are the different kinds of hobs?

Induction hobs are generally the most energy-efficient, converting over 90% of their energy into heat. Gas hobs generally offer around 40-55% effectiveness, while electric hobs can be less efficient, depending upon the design.
